BSH Home Appliances Ltd, a subsidiary company of the BSH Bosch und Siemens Hausgeräte GmbH, plans to set up a manufacturing facility in Tamil Nadu. The new facility will attract an investment of a little over Rs 475 crore.

Tamil Nadu Chief Minister handed over the land allocation letter to V K Viswanathan, who represented BSH Home Appliances Pvt Ltd, in Chennai on Sunday.

The facility will be spread over 42 acres at Pillaipakkam, SIPCOT, in Kancheepuram district. The facility will provide employment to 1,000 people directly and another 1,000 indirect jobs would be created, according to state government release.

BSH Home Appliances Ltd. a subsidiary company of the BSH Bosch und Siemens Hausgeräte GmbH, a group with worldwide operations, which posts annual sales in the year 2007 in excess of Euro 8,8 billion. Founded in 1967, as a joint venture between Robert-Bosch GmbH, Stuttgart, and Siemens AG, Berlin and Munich, BSH offers major domestic appliances, consumer products and domestic technology.

Starting with 13 production sites in three countries, it has expanded its activities to encompass 43 factories in 14 countries in Europe, the USA, Latin America and Asia, according to information available on the company’s website.
